Content Description

Lithograph of an invitation to the Knights of Pythias regular convention in New Brunswick. The convention was held in 1908. The invitation states that it should be destroyed once it is read. It also asks for sick or disabled members to contact listed members of their lodge

Scope and Contents From the Collection: The Ralph B. Duncan postcard collection consists of postcards with a Masonic connection, either a building used for Masonic purposes, a person connected to Freemasonry, or a subject concerning Freemasonry. Mostly made during 1907-1940s, there are some that are both earlier and later, which can be determined by changes in postcard conventions.
